Carleton University’s Pauline Jewett Institute of Women's and Gender Studies is pleased to announce that Flora Terah will deliver the 2010 Florence Bird Lecture.

Her lecture entitled Broken Bodies, Unbroken Spirit will be presented on Wednesday, March 10 at 11:30 a.m. in Room 302, Azrielli Theatre.

On September 7, 2007, Ms. Terah, a Kenyan parliamentary candidate in the Meru district of Kenya, was brutally attacked and warned against running for Parliament. As a result of the attack, Terah was hospitalised for weeks and lost her bid for election. In March 2008, her only child was murdered.

The lecture is free and open to the public.
